Frightened Horse Bolts With Gig
girl thrown out
receives fatal injuries Press Association . CHRISTCHURCH, To-day. Miss Ellen M. Fraer, a resident of Kaikoura, and formerly of Christchurch, a, sister of t£ie Rev. C. A. Fraer, Phillips town, was killed in an accident near Hundalee Reserve, Goose Bay. yesterday. The Misses Fraer were driving in a K ig when the horse took fright at passing motor-cyclists and holted. Miss Ellen Fraer was thrown out and suffered serious injuries, resulting in her death a few hours later.
